This is a mini course explaining my process of making 3d-printed boxes with cutouts for your tools.

The main goal of this course is to help you actually design and 3D print your own custom drawer boxes — not just to follow along. And as a bonus, you’ll naturally pick up some key Fusion skills along the way that you can use in many other projects. I do want to stress however - this isn't a course in Fusion but we will go through a bunch of the tools in it to create our boxes.

In this course you will learn

  • how to make simple storage boxes
  • how to make more advanced storage boxes with cut outs from shapes
    • using photos
    • by measuring
  • how to make stackable boxes.
  • How to make custom Gridfinity boxes. 
  • You will also get a glimpse of the Shaper trace and the 3d scanner as optional tools. 

We’ll use a few basic tools:

  • Autodesk Fusion (free for personal use)
  • a measuring tool like a caliper or ruler. 
  • a smartphone.
  • a 3D printer to print your creations.
  • Optional - Shaper Trace (for converting drawings to SVG)
  • Optional - 3D scanner
  • Optional - 3d printed radius gauge
